Increasing KeyControl Storage in a VM

If you installed KeyControl in a VM, you can increase the amount of storage available without reinstalling KeyControl. You just need to increase the size of the underlying disk and reboot the KeyControl node.

Important: If you upgraded to Version 10.4.3, you must delete the pre-upgrade snapshots before you start. See Delete KeyControl Snapshots.

  1. Increase the size of the virtual disk in which KeyControl is installed using your hypervisor tools.

    Note: You may need to shut down the VM before you can resize the disk. For details, see your hypervisor documentation.

  2. Log into the KeyControl Vault Management webGUI using an account with Domain Admin privileges.
  3. In the top right, click the Switch to Appliance Management link.
  4. In the top menu bar, click Cluster.
  5. Select the KeyControl node whose disk you just resized in the list.
  6. Select Actions > System Reboot.
  7. If necessary, log back into the webGUI after the KeyControl node has rebooted.
  8. Review the Audit Log messages. The node should report the new size upon success or provide information if the resize failed.
